About APPLE SPRINGS EL

Set in APPLE SPRINGS, Texas, APPLE SPRINGS EL is a minimally staffed elementary school, overseen by APPLE SPRINGS ISD. It caters to 83 students across grades pre-K through 6. Enrollment runs roughly 84% smaller than the state mean of about 519.

Within APPLE SPRINGS ISD, which oversees 2 schools and 179 students, APPLE SPRINGS EL is one campus in the system.

Demographically, APPLE SPRINGS EL lists that nearly all students (84%) are White. Other groups include 7% Hispanic, 6% Black.

Looking at school resources, Staff filings list 8 full-time-equivalent teachers, which works out to roughly 10.4:1 students per teacher.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 15.1:1, putting APPLE SPRINGS EL tighter than the state norm the norm. Around 76% of the student body qualifies for free or reduced-price meals,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ator.

On a demographically-adjusted basis, APPLE SPRINGS EL tracks the demographic baseline. The model predicts 40.7% given the school's FRL share; actual proficiency is 37.5%.

In the surrounding community, census data for Trinity County shows median household earnings sit near $52,018, roughly 17%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and roughly 13% of residents live below the federal poverty line. APPLE SPRINGS EL is one of 8 public schools in Trinity County (combined enrollment of about 2,257 students).

Nearest neighbor: APPLE SPRINGS H S, around 0.0 miles off. 3 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a ten-mile radius, suggesting a relatively low-density school footprint. Among the 8 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), APPLE SPRINGS EL ranks 7th on composite proficiency, beneath the local average of 51.5%.

Geographically, the school is in a rural area.

Trend over the last 7 years. Over the past 7-year window, the student count decreased 32%: 122 students in 2018 compared to 83 in 2025. White enrollment moved from 89% to 84% across the same window. The student-to-teacher ratio tightened from 15.1:1 in 2018 to 10.4:1 today.
